About the Role
We are looking for a detail-oriented Nutrition & Dietetic Assistant to join our Nutrition & Dietetics team. This role will support the collection, validation and maintenance of nutrition, allergen and ingredient data, ensuring product information is accurate, compliant and up to date.
Working closely with the Head of Nutrition & Dietetics, internal teams and external suppliers, you will play a key role in supporting the implementation of the Ivalua system, including data loading (PriCat), data quality assurance and User Acceptance Testing (UAT). You will also support menu analysis and wider nutrition projects across the business.
Key Responsibilities
- Collect, verify and maintain nutrition, allergen and ingredient data.
- Support the implementation of Ivalua and PriCat data loading processes.
- Conduct quality checks on product specifications and nutrition information.
- Liaise with suppliers, manufacturers and internal stakeholders to obtain and validate data.
- Support menu analysis and nutrition-related projects.
- Provide guidance on nutrition and allergen queries.
- Identify and resolve data discrepancies to ensure compliance and consumer safety.
Essential Skills & Experience
- UK Registered Dietitian or Registered Nutritionist with relevant food industry experience.
- Knowledge of food labelling, allergens, nutrition information and product specifications.
- Excellent attention to detail and strong organisational skills.
- Confident working with databases, Excel and other data management systems.
- Strong communication skills with the ability to build effective stakeholder relationships.
- Able to manage multiple priorities while maintaining a high level of accuracy.
